Dynamic Tree for Load-On-Demand Content
Question
Hi!
We need an AJAX runtime-modifiable tree widget.
A quick search through the forums reveals this post:
https://www.outsystems.com/networkforums/viewtopic.aspx?topicid=3096
in which Paulo Ramos says, "The eSpace in attach contains a web block designed for dynamically building a tree".
I've tried to alter the record list (in a copy of the sample) at runtime, but an AJAX refresh of the widget doesn't have the desired effect (for example, adding a record to the tree's record list and refreshing the widget does not work as expected).
Can a Load-On-Demand tree be easily implemented using either JSTree or the TreeWidget component? If not, how easy is it to incorporate a third party widget?
Or, does anyone have any better suggestions / recommendations? Maybe I'm using the widget incorrectly :-)
